“Alice.” He felt his lips form the word but couldn’t hear it. It was incredibly quiet; he hadn’t expected an accident scene to be this deathly silent. He tried again, called her name, and felt his throat tighten and hoarsen as he kept calling and calling without once uttering a sound. She didn’t move, she merely watched him, and he went cold with dread. She hated him. God, he had known that she would eventually hate him . . . he had always known it. He had spent the past two years waiting for her to fall out of love with him. He wasn’t good enough for her love. Some part of him had always known that the son of a monster didn’t deserve such a glorious creature’s love. Still, he begged and pleaded with her to come to him. God, she was so lovely, he adored her in that dress, he always had.
